ATLANTA--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Sep 4, 2025--
Ministry Brands, the leading provider of church software and online giving solutions, today announced their upcoming Season to ShineHealthy Church Summit, a free online event on September 17 featuring worship leadership workshops, exclusive musical performances, and practical training from trusted ministry and technology experts. Designed for pastors and ministry teams, the summit will equip attendees to plan more meaningful holiday services, enrich worship and creative elements, and streamline operations into the new year.

Programming Highlights
The summit will feature breakout workshops and discussions led by respected ministry voices and church operations experts, including Ben Stapley, an executive pastor and church consultant, and Mark MacDonald, a church brand strategist. Further, a selection of Ministry Brands’ leading technology partners will also be in attendance and leading breakout sessions:
- AvidXchange: Simplifying accounts payable with secure, automated payment systems integrated with Ministry Brands’ suite of digital and financial platforms.
- WavMaker: Providing churches with royalty-free, professionally curated music to elevate storytelling, livestreams, and creative projects.
- eSPACE by Smart Church Solutions: Equipping churches to steward facilities with event scheduling, maintenance management, and energy savings tools.
Session topics will include planning memorable Christmas services, streamlining holiday communications, preparing facilities for increased attendance, and strengthening church finances and operations. In addition, attendees will hear from influencers and practitioners who will share creative ideas for rallying volunteers, energizing worship teams, and telling more compelling stories through music and media.
Exclusive Musical Performances
Alongside the educational content, the summit will showcase exclusive, in-studio performances from viral and award-winning Christian artists Anthem Lights, Jacquelyn George, and Caleb & Kelsey. Sponsored by WavMaker, each artist will debut original arrangements of beloved worship and Christmas songs, professionally produced to create a unique worship experience for the summit audiences. These recordings will later become available to churches as licensed, copyright-free versions.

Full Event Details
The Season to Shine Healthy Church Summit will take place online on Tuesday, September 17, 2025, at 1:00 p.m. ET / 10:00 a.m. PT. The free, two-hour event is open to pastors, worship leaders, church staff, volunteers, and anyone involved in ministry operations or creative planning.

About Ministry Brands
Ministry Brands helps more than 90,000 churches and non-profit organizations grow and increase their impact on the world. The company provides integrated solutions covering member and donor management, digital giving, accounting, websites, mobile apps, communications, media content, event planning, employee, and volunteer background screenings, and more. Together, their nearly 700 employees help clients transform how they operate and create positive ripple effects that drive the real human impact for which we all strive. With over $6.45 billion in charitable giving managed annually, they exist to help mission-focused organizations thrive.
